Mission & Programs · Part III

Where the work happens

3 program services account for $2.3M of program spending, described in the organization's own filed words · FY2024.
01

Clean & SafeThe U District Partnership (UDP) has taken a proactive and collaborative approach to addressing litter and cleanliness challenges in the neighborhood through a strategic partnership with the City of Seattle and Recology.

$2.3Mprogram expense
02

Economic Development and EventsExpanded light rail service, new residential development, and an increase in the UW student population continue to enhance neighborhood vibrancy and visitation.

Pt IX · col B
03

Urban VitalityThe long-awaited tables have officially arrived in the U District, bringing a fresh update to one of the neighborhood's most beloved gathering spaces. The U District Partnership (UDP) partnered with JumpShip Mfg to design and deliver a new set of tables for the 43rd Street Plaza, replacing the well-used picnic tables that…
